New Music, the Good, Bad and ... You decide?

New visuals this week the Mad Music continues to be dynamic. We found these 3 new music visuals keeping it Dancehall and Hype. Not sure any of these are going to be BIG hits but give us your feedback.

1st up Vybz Kartel advocate, supporter and friend Busta" Bus a Bus" Rhymes finally lands a colab  with Vybz and Torey Lanez. This one has a nice beat, but the  numerous stops and starts to the video breaks the flow. Although there are cameos from Beenie Man, Junior Reid, Foota Hype Sizzla and a bag of Jamaican artists the dialogue and over use of "patois" doesn't come across at all as natural.


Then there is this new one from Popcaan and Kyla. Fo rthose who dont know  Kyla, is a British house music singer in the UK funky subgenre. She is best known for her song "Do You Mind" which became one of the most successful charting UK funky songs and was later featured on Drake's 2016 international hit "One Dance".



Finally we have the two "Jamericans" who are holding on to their Jamaica roots to try and get a further foothold in the hip-pop market. Sean Kingston who from day one embraced his heritage in his stage name and then Safaree previously known as Niki Minaj's Hypeman but now carving a name for himself as a rapper and regular staple in the dancehall.

Should have been Popcaan in this Video

You are probably bouncing to this happy pop tune "Should have been Me" by British Producer Naughty Boy featuring Kyla and Jamaica's own Popcaan.



This horn infused tune has Popcaan taking a leaf from Sean Paul's book and jumping on the collab train  and finding success particular in the British and European Market. Popcaan di Unruly Boss with jus a a few bars adds a winning flavour to a big chune.

The video for this one is very cinematic and well shot in Kampala, Uganada  but we a pree it  and can't understand how this was  green lighted. the video has ABSOLUTELY nothing to do with the song.

The song is all about love and relationships only relationship  we see is this is a new found passion for skateboarding.


Pretty video,  nice imagery but nothing to do with  the reality . Check Poppy's lyrics " Mi guess that a so di ting go , a brand new girl me a swing to ......" Wi nuh see how dat factor in the video
